Just as an example, if you have a team that abnormally will cover 12 (vs. 6) points more than what is expected in general, then it may be more +EV to teas that team vs playing them straight up at +6. I don't know if your system generates this type of analysis, but certainly its feasible.
No, its not. For a few reasons: A) The way scoring is done in the NFL. After you cross the 3/7, the chances of a game landing on a particular # drop considerably. Making your theroy basically mathmatically impossible. B) No handicapper (well a winning one) is that enamored with himself enough to think that he can predict the scores of games within 6 points (again, unless the line is in the 3/7 area) Anyway, I'm done with this discussion.
